About Wesley Even

Wesley Even, With an exceptional h-index of 28 and a recent h-index of 20 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Southern Utah University, specializes in the field of Astrophysics, Computational Physics, Radiation Hydrodynamics, High Energy Density Physics.

His recent articles reflect a diverse array of research interests and contributions to the field:

Abundances and Transients from Neutron Star–White Dwarf Mergers

Halted-pendulum Relaxation: Application to White Dwarf Binary Initial Data

Initialization of Compact Star Orbits Using External Potential Relaxation Scheme

Conservation of Angular Momentum in the Fast Multipole Method

Fully Dynamical General Relativistic SPH: Progress and Challenges

StaNdaRT: a repository of standardised test models and outputs for supernova radiative transfer

A comprehensive study of the radiative properties of NO—a first step toward a complete air opacity

Studying Expansion of Ejecta from Binary Neutron Star Mergers
